When to go to Point Lookout
Don't overlook the weather when planning your trip. January brings the warmest conditions, with temperatures reaching highs of 30ºC.
Expect lows of 10ºC in July, the coolest time of year.
Search for Point Lookout hotels in July for the best chance of clearer skies. Averaging three days of rain, this is the driest month.
The wettest time of year is March. Take your trip then and you'll likely get around ten days of rainfall.
